<p class="MsoNormal"><span style="mso-spacerun: 'yes'; font-family: Calibri; mso-fareast-font-family: 宋体; mso-bidi-font-family: 'Times New Roman'; font-size: 10.5000pt; mso-font-kerning: 1.0000pt;">A built-in bypass soft starter is designed to manage two key phases of motor operation. During startup, it controls voltage rise to limit current surge and mechanical shock. Once the motor reaches nominal speed, the internal bypass path allows current to flow directly, reducing continuous loading on power electronics. This dual-phase control strategy reflects a practical response to real-world operating conditions rather than a focus on startup performance alone.</span>
<p class="MsoNormal"><span style="mso-spacerun: 'yes'; font-family: Calibri; mso-fareast-font-family: 宋体; mso-bidi-font-family: 'Times New Roman'; font-size: 10.5000pt; mso-font-kerning: 1.0000pt;">Within a Soft Starter Cabinet, space utilization and component coordination are ongoing design considerations. Integrating the bypass function directly into the soft starter reduces the need for additional external contactors and wiring. This not only simplifies the internal layout but also lowers the risk of wiring errors during assembly or maintenance. For panel builders managing multiple projects, such integration supports consistent cabinet design and predictable assembly workflows.</span>
<p class="MsoNormal"><span style="mso-spacerun: 'yes'; font-family: Calibri; mso-fareast-font-family: 宋体; mso-bidi-font-family: 'Times New Roman'; font-size: 10.5000pt; mso-font-kerning: 1.0000pt;">Motor protection is another area where built-in bypass designs contribute practical value. During startup, controlled acceleration reduces mechanical stress on shafts, couplings, and driven equipment. After the transition to bypass, reduced heat generation within the starter supports stable electrical behavior. This balance helps protect both the motor and associated mechanical systems over repeated operating cycles.</span>
<p class="MsoNormal"><span style="mso-spacerun: 'yes'; font-family: Calibri; mso-fareast-font-family: 宋体; mso-bidi-font-family: 'Times New Roman'; font-size: 10.5000pt; mso-font-kerning: 1.0000pt;">In applications such as pumping systems and ventilation equipment, motors often run continuously for long periods after startup. In these cases, minimizing energy loss during steady operation becomes more relevant than optimizing short startup events. A Soft Starter Cabinet using a built-in bypass soft starter addresses this by allowing the motor to operate with reduced internal losses once normal speed is achieved.</span>
<p class="MsoNormal"><span style="mso-spacerun: 'yes'; font-family: Calibri; mso-fareast-font-family: 宋体; mso-bidi-font-family: 'Times New Roman'; font-size: 10.5000pt; mso-font-kerning: 1.0000pt;">Another reason for growing interest lies in system coordination and fault handling. Many modern soft starters include protection features such as overload detection, phase loss monitoring, and temperature feedback. When these functions are combined with an internal bypass mechanism, the control system can respond more consistently to abnormal operating conditions without relying on multiple external devices. This integrated approach supports clearer fault diagnosis and easier troubleshooting for maintenance teams.</span>
